About the job At Accurx, the User Support team plays a critical role in helping our users, from healthcare staff in GP practices and hospitals to patients themselves, make the most of our products. We’re on a mission to fix the broken communication in healthcare, and your work here directly impacts the care received by millions across the UK. This isn’t your typical support role. As well as speaking directly with users via Intercom, you’ll also have the opportunity to be assigned a specialism, becoming the expert in a particular area of our product. You’ll act as the bridge between our users, the support team, and our product team, ensuring that user feedback is heard and that upcoming features and changes are well communicated and understood. This is a unique opportunity to gain experience working closely with a product team while continuing to deliver hands-on, high-quality support to those who need it. Your day to day tasks, should you choose to accept this mission 🤝... Speaking to users and patients via Intercom, offering clear, empathetic and solution-focused support. Becoming an expert in a designated area of the Accurx product, acting as the go-to for both the User Support team and our Product team. Collating and presenting user feedback, helping shape the development of new features. Preparing our internal teams and external users for upcoming product releases.
